When we talk about protein powder for weight loss in 2026, we aren't talking about magic shakes. We are talking about Satiety, Thermic Effect, and Muscle Preservation.

The scientific reality is simple: Protein is the most satiating macronutrient. It requires more energy to digest (Thermic Effect of Food or TEF) than fats or carbs, and it protects your lean muscle mass while you are in a caloric deficit. If you lose muscle, your metabolism slows down. Therefore, the best weight loss powder is the one that helps you hit your protein targets without adding excess sugar, fillers, or empty calories.

The Science of Protein and Weight Loss

Before you make your purchase, it is vital to understand why these specific products work. Weight loss isn't just about calories in versus calories out; it's about hormonal control.

1. The Thermic Effect of Protein

Your body burns calories simply by digesting food. This is called the Thermic Effect of Food (TEF). Protein has a TEF of roughly 20-30%, compared to 0-3% for fat and 5-10% for carbs. This means if you eat 100 calories of pure protein, your body burns 20-30 calories just processing it. High-protein powders like the Dymatize ISO100 essentially "boost" your metabolism passively.

2. Muscle Protein Synthesis (MPS)

When you are in a calorie deficit, your body looks for energy. It can break down fat (good) or muscle (bad). Muscle tissue is metabolically active—it burns fat. To signal your body not to eat its own muscle, you need sufficient Leucine. Leucine is an amino acid found in high concentrations in Whey and quality plant blends. It triggers the mTOR pathway, which tells your body to synthesize muscle tissue.

Recommendation: Ensure your powder has at least 2.5g of Leucine per serving (most of the above do).

Buyer’s Checklist: What to Avoid in 2026

The label can be deceiving. Here is what I tell my clients to watch out for when shopping for a weight-loss protein:

  1. Proprietary Blends: If the label says "Protein Blend" without listing the exact grams of each source, put it back. You don't know if it's 90% cheap fillers or 90% quality protein.
  2. "Weight Loss" Cocktails: Avoid powders that claim to have "fat-burning pills" inside them. They are often loaded with stimulants and caffeine that can cause cortisol spikes (stress hormone), leading to belly fat retention.
  3. Hidden Sugars: Look for monk fruit, stevia, or allulose. Avoid maltodextrin, corn syrup solids, or dextrose. These spike insulin and halt fat burning.
  4. Heavy Metals: Plant-based powders (rice/pea) can absorb heavy metals from the soil. Always choose brands that test for heavy metals. Both Garden of Life and Vega perform rigorous third-party testing.
